Colocalization of synaptophysin with transferrin receptors: implications for synaptic vesicle biogenesis
We have reported previously that the synaptic vesicle (SV) protein synaptophysin, when expressed in fibroblastic CHO cells, accumulates in a population of recycling microvesicles.
